3Roam commercialises and develops advanced high capacity products for wireless and MPLS/IP convergence. 3Roam provides a range of logn reach microwave devices enabling operators to deploy carrier grade networks, for the backhaul of cellular 2G/3G/LTE base stations, WiMAX or TV broadcast.
